**Pa amb tomaquet**, or tomato bread, is a classic Catalan dish that is simple to make yet bursting with flavor. It is a popular breakfast, lunch, or snack that can be enjoyed any time of day. The basic recipe consists of toasted bread rubbed with garlic and tomato, then drizzled with olive oil and sprinkled with salt. In this article, you will find three variations on this classic dish:

* **Traditional pa amb tomaquet:** This recipe uses fresh tomatoes, garlic, and olive oil. It is the most basic and traditional version of the dish.
* **Pa amb tomaquet with jamón:** This recipe adds salty, cured ham to the traditional ingredients. It is a hearty and flavorful variation that is perfect for a quick lunch or dinner.
* **Pa amb tomaquet with escalivada:** This recipe adds roasted vegetables, such as eggplant, peppers, and onions, to the traditional ingredients. It is a colorful and delicious variation that is perfect for a summer meal.

PA AMB TOMAQUET (TOMATO TOAST)



Pa Amb Tomaquet (Tomato Toast) image

From "Zingerman's Guide to Good Eating" (a cookbook I HIGHLY recommend), this is an absolutely delicious Catalan garlic toast soaked with tomato juices and drizzled with olive oil and sea salt! It can be topped with chopped olives, capers, anchovies or serrano ham and is incredibly wonderful when the bread is grilled and a good olive oil is used. And, this is a good way to use up fresh tomatoes that are getting a little past their prime.

Number Of Ingredients 5

4 slices thick good crusty Italian bread or 4 slices French bread
1 tomatoes, halved
1 clove garlic, halved
olive oil, to taste
sea salt

Steps:

  • Grill or toast bread slices.
  • Rub grilled bread with garlic halves, then rub tomato halves into bread; really mash them on there- the idea here is to soak the bread tops with the tomato juices.
  • Discard tomatoes.
  • Drizzle bread with good olive oil to taste, then sprinkle with some sea salt.
  • Serve hot.

PAN CON TOMATE RECIPE (SPANISH TOMATO BREAD)



Pan con Tomate Recipe (Spanish Tomato Bread) image

Pan con tomate, also known in Spain as pan tumaca or pa amb tomàquet in Catalan, is toasted bread topped with juicy tomatoes, extra virgin olive oil, garlic, and salt. - delicious!

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 tomatoes (juicy and ripe tomatoes on the vine work well)
Extra virgin olive oil (to taste)
1 clove of garlic (cut in half)
Salt to taste
1 loaf bread (rustic, or unleavened bread (works best for avoiding sogginess and maintaining crunchiness))
A few thin slices of Spanish Serrano or Iberian ham (optional, but highly recommended)

Steps:

  • Cut the bread into slices of toast with medium thickness. Arrange on a baking sheet, and toast the bread slices in the oven at 250°F (120°C) for about five to ten minutes, flipping halfway through.
  • Wash and dry the tomatoes. Cut them in half, and grate them using a box grater, discarding the stem and skins.
  • Once the tomatoes are grated, reserve in a small bowl and add about 1 tablespoon of olive oil and a pinch of salt. Taste, and adjust if necessary.
  • Cut the clove of garlic in half and rub the raw garlic on the toasted bread. Then carefully spoon the tomato mixture onto the slices of garlic toast, and top with a drizzle of extra virgin olive oil and a sprinkle of sea salt.
  • Optionally, top with a slice of jamón (Serrano or Iberian) for additional flavor, and a more hearty toast. Enjoy!

Tips: Achieving the Best Pa amb Tomaquet

  • Select ripe, flavorful tomatoes: Use vine-ripened tomatoes for the best taste. They should be red and juicy, with no bruises or blemishes.
  • Toast the bread properly: Toasting the bread until it's golden brown adds a delightful crunch and smokiness to the dish.
  • Use good-quality olive oil: Extra virgin olive oil is the best choice for this dish, as it has a rich flavor and aroma.
  • Season generously: Don't be shy with the salt and pepper. They help to bring out the flavors of the tomatoes and olive oil.
  • Add optional toppings: Feel free to customize your Pa amb Tomaquet with additional toppings such as Serrano ham, Manchego cheese, or roasted peppers.
